了解Chromedriver

Chromedriver是一个独立的服务器,用于实现Chrome浏览器的自动化操作,通过Chromedriver,我们可以使用各种编程语言(如Python、Java等)来模拟用户操作Chrome浏览器,从而实现自动化测试、网页爬虫等功能。

安装Chromedriver

  1. 下载Chromedriver

我们需要从Chrome官方网站或可信的第三方网站下载对应版本的Chromedriver,下载时,务必选择与自己的Chrome浏览器版本相匹配的Chromedriver版本。

  1. 安装Chromedriver

下载完成后,解压缩Chromedriver到指定目录,在Windows系统中,你可以将其放在任意目录;在Linux系统中,建议将其放在/usr/local/bin目录下,以便系统识别。

配置Chromedriver

  1. 设置环境变量

为了能够在命令行中直接运行Chromedriver,我们需要将其所在目录添加到系统环境变量中,在Windows系统中,可以通过“系统属性” -> “高级” -> “环境变量”进行设置;在Linux系统中,可以在~/.bashrc~/.bash_profile文件中添加export命令。

  1. 在代码中配置Chromedriver

Chromedriver的安装与配置

当使用Chromedriver进行自动化测试或爬虫时,需要在代码中指定Chromedriver的路径,不同编程语言指定路径的方式可能有所不同,可以查阅相应语言的Chromedriver使用文档以获取具体方法。

启动Chromedriver

配置完成后,即可启动Chromedriver服务器,在命令行中输入“chromedriver”即可启动服务器,如果需要将Chromedriver与自动化测试框架(如Selenium)结合使用,可以在代码中启动Chromedriver。

注意事项

  1. 下载Chromedriver时,务必选择与自己的Chrome浏览器版本相匹配的版本,否则可能会出现不兼容的情况。
  2. 在配置环境变量时,要注意路径的正确性,避免因路径错误导致无法运行Chromedriver。
  3. 使用Chromedriver进行自动化测试或爬虫时,需确保Chromedriver服务器已经启动,并正确指定Chromedriver的路径。

安装与配置Chromedriver其实并不复杂,只需按照本文介绍的步骤进行操作,即可顺利上手,如果在过程中遇到问题,建议查阅官方文档或搜索相关资料寻求解决之道。